Ngò Gai/Culantro/Sawtooth Herb/ Thorny Coriander… is a great addition to the Herb Garnish for Phở and Sweet and Sour Fish or Shrimp Soup (Canh Chua).

A lot of Peruvian Recipes use Cilantro sometimes in conjunction with Ahi Amarillo or Green Rocoto Peppers.
A few examples:
Aji Verde (Sauce)
Green Rice
Sometimes in Tallarines Verdes
Seco de Res (or uses Culanrto)
